TSS President Tahir Ahad emails Board President Tina Fredericks before TSS has been formally contracted. Ahad advises on language and recommends keeping their discussions from the superintendent.
"I think it would be best to not mention our discussions to the superintendent and let her own the process."Tahir Ahad, TSS President, email to Board President Tina Fredericks, December 1, 2025
Ahad advised Fredericks about "friendlier language" for discussing closures, suggesting terms like "School Reconfiguration" and "School Optimization."Colorado Boulevard, May 11, 2026
The PUSD board approves TSS's $233,300 contract to serve as the consolidation process consultant. The contract passes 5–2.
At the SCAC meeting, TSS Executive Vice President Joseph Pandolfo concedes that his projected cost savings for each proposed school closure were inaccurate and overstated. He had used wrong data and failed to account for the $24.5 million in budget cuts the PUSD board had already passed in November 2025.
